Services include, but are not limited to, routine physical exams and wellness screenings, diagnosis and treatment of medical concerns for acute illness or injury, diagnosis and treatment of sexual health concerns, immunizations, diagnostic testing, preventative health services and education. Students are requested to make appointments in advance for non-emergencies. Services include routine physical exams and cancer screenings, evaluation of sexual and reproductive health concerns, hormone therapy management and preventative health education.  Referrals to local healthcare specialists, including providers who specialize in hormone therapy initiation and gender reassignment surgery are provided when needed or requested.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a href=\"\/health-services\/services\/men\/\">Men\u2019s Health Services<\/a><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>Men\u2019s Health Services are available for individuals assigned male at birth who are seeking information, healthcare, and\/or support. Services include routine physical exams and cancer screenings, evaluation of sexual health concerns, diagnoses and treatment of genital and other infections, and preventative health education. Referrals to local healthcare specialists are provided when needed or requested.  <\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a href=\"\/health-services\/services\/women\/\">Gynecological Services<\/a><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>Gynecological Services are available for individuals assigned female at birth who are seeking information, healthcare, and\/or support. Processing lab facilities will bill the patient's insurance and all other applicable fees (ex. co-pays) will then be billed to the insurance policy holder. If the patient wishes to have blood work drawn at an outside facility, VCHS can provide a lab requisition form to facilitate this request.  X-rays, MRIs, and similar diagnostic tests will be ordered by VCHS providers and will then be scheduled by appointment at local imaging facilities.  The imaging facility will bill the patient's insurance and all other applicable fees will then be billed to the insurance policy holder.  <\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><a href=\"https:\/\/pages.vassar.edu\/vcems\/\">Vassar College Emergency Medical Service<\/a><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>Vassar College Emergency Medical Services (VCEMS) is a student-run organization that is part of the Vassar Student Association (VSA). VCEMS is a National Collegiate EMS Foundation (NCEMSF) recognized EMS organization that serves all members of the Vassar College community and visitors to the campus during the academic year. VCEMS responds to on-campus emergencies and operates most nights from 5:00pm- 130am. VCEMS also provides extra coverage during large-scale campus events such as Commencement.
